Azure Event Hubs Consumer Groups API

Operations for managing consumer groups within an event hub.

Operations 4

GET /subscriptions/{subscriptionId}/resourceGroups/{resourceGroupName}/providers/Microsoft.EventHub/namespaces/{namespaceName}/eventhubs/{eventHubName}/consumergroups Azure Event Hubs List consumer groups #
PUT /subscriptions/{subscriptionId}/resourceGroups/{resourceGroupName}/providers/Microsoft.EventHub/namespaces/{namespaceName}/eventhubs/{eventHubName}/consumergroups/{consumerGroupName} Azure Event Hubs Create or update a consumer group #
GET /subscriptions/{subscriptionId}/resourceGroups/{resourceGroupName}/providers/Microsoft.EventHub/namespaces/{namespaceName}/eventhubs/{eventHubName}/consumergroups/{consumerGroupName} Azure Event Hubs Get a consumer group #
DELETE /subscriptions/{subscriptionId}/resourceGroups/{resourceGroupName}/providers/Microsoft.EventHub/namespaces/{namespaceName}/eventhubs/{eventHubName}/consumergroups/{consumerGroupName} Azure Event Hubs Delete a consumer group #

OpenAPI Specification

microsoft-azure-event-hubs-consumer-groups-api-openapi.yml Raw ↑
openapi: 3.2.0
info:
  title: Azure Event Hubs Management REST Consumer Groups API
  description: Azure Resource Manager REST API for managing Event Hubs namespaces, event hubs, consumer groups, authorization rules, disaster recovery configurations, and schema registry groups. This API uses the Microsoft.EventHub resource provider and operates on the Azure management plane at management.azure.com.
  version: '2024-01-01'
  contact:
    name: Microsoft Azure Support
    url: https://azure.microsoft.com/en-us/support/
  license:
    name: Microsoft Azure Terms of Service
    url: https://azure.microsoft.com/en-us/support/legal/
  x-logo:
    url: https://azure.microsoft.com/svghandler/event-hubs/
servers:
- url: https://management.azure.com
  description: Azure Resource Manager
security:
- azure_auth:
  - user_impersonation
tags:
- name: Consumer Groups
  description: Operations for managing consumer groups within an event hub.
paths:
  ? /subscriptions/{subscriptionId}/resourceGroups/{resourceGroupName}/providers/Microsoft.EventHub/namespaces/{namespaceName}/eventhubs/{eventHubName}/consumergroups
  : get:
      operationId: ConsumerGroups_ListByEventHub
      summary: Azure Event Hubs List consumer groups
      description: Gets all the consumer groups in a Namespace. An empty feed is returned if no consumer group exists in the Namespace.
      tags:
      - Consumer Groups
      parameters:
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/SubscriptionIdPar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/ResourceGroupN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/NamespaceN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/EventHubN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/ApiVersionParameter'
      - name: $skip
        in: query
        schema:
          type: integer
          minimum: 0
          maximum: 1000
      - name: $top
        in: query
        schema:
          type: integer
          minimum: 1
          maximum: 1000
      responses:
        '200':
          description: Successfully retrieved the list of consumer groups.
          content:
            application/json:
              schema:
                $ref: '#/components/schemas/ConsumerGroupListResult'
        default:
          description: Event Hubs error response describing why the operation failed.
          content:
            application/json:
              schema:
                $ref: '#/components/schemas/ErrorResponse'
  ? /subscriptions/{subscriptionId}/resourceGroups/{resourceGroupName}/providers/Microsoft.EventHub/namespaces/{namespaceName}/eventhubs/{eventHubName}/consumergroups/{consumerGroupName}
  : put:
      operationId: ConsumerGroups_CreateOrUpdate
      summary: Azure Event Hubs Create or update a consumer group
      description: Creates or updates an Event Hubs consumer group as a nested resource within a Namespace.
      tags:
      - Consumer Groups
      parameters:
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/SubscriptionIdPar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/ResourceGroupN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/NamespaceN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/EventHubN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/ConsumerGroupN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/ApiVersionParameter'
      requestBody:
        required: true
        description: Parameters supplied to create or update a consumer group resource.
        content:
          application/json:
            schema:
              $ref: '#/components/schemas/ConsumerGroup'
      responses:
        '200':
          description: Consumer group successfully created.
          content:
            application/json:
              schema:
                $ref: '#/components/schemas/ConsumerGroup'
        default:
          description: Event Hubs error response describing why the operation failed.
          content:
            application/json:
              schema:
                $ref: '#/components/schemas/ErrorResponse'
    get:
      operationId: ConsumerGroups_Get
      summary: Azure Event Hubs Get a consumer group
      description: Gets a description for the specified consumer group.
      tags:
      - Consumer Groups
      parameters:
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/SubscriptionIdPar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/ResourceGroupN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/NamespaceN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/EventHubN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/ConsumerGroupN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/ApiVersionParameter'
      responses:
        '200':
          description: Successfully retrieved the consumer group description.
          content:
            application/json:
              schema:
                $ref: '#/components/schemas/ConsumerGroup'
        default:
          description: Event Hubs error response describing why the operation failed.
          content:
            application/json:
              schema:
                $ref: '#/components/schemas/ErrorResponse'
    delete:
      operationId: ConsumerGroups_Delete
      summary: Azure Event Hubs Delete a consumer group
      description: Deletes a consumer group from the specified Event Hub and resource group.
      tags:
      - Consumer Groups
      parameters:
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/SubscriptionIdPar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/ResourceGroupN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/NamespaceN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/EventHubN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/ConsumerGroupNameParameter'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/ApiVersionParameter'
      responses:
        '200':
          description: Consumer group successfully deleted.
        '204':
          description: No content.
        default:
          description: Event Hubs error response describing why the operation failed.
          content:
            application/json:
              schema:
                $ref: '#/components/schemas/ErrorResponse'
components:
  schemas:
    ErrorResponse:
      type: object
      description: Error response indicates Event Hub service is not able to process the incoming request. The reason is provided in the error message.
      properties:
        error:
          $ref: '#/components/schemas/ErrorDetail'
    SystemData:
      type: object
      description: Metadata pertaining to creation and last modification of the resource.
      properties:
        createdBy:
          type: string
          description: The identity that created the resource.
        createdByType:
          type: string
          description: The type of identity that created the resource.
          enum:
          - User
          - Application
          - ManagedIdentity
          - Key
        createdAt:
          type: string
          format: date-time
          description: The timestamp of resource creation (UTC).
        lastModifiedBy:
          type: string
          description: The identity that last modified the resource.
        lastModifiedByType:
          type: string
          description: The type of identity that last modified the resource.
          enum:
          - User
          - Application
          - ManagedIdentity
          - Key
        lastModifiedAt:
          type: string
          format: date-time
          description: The timestamp of resource last modification (UTC).
    ConsumerGroup:
      type: object
      description: Single item in List or Get Consumer group operation.
      properties:
        id:
          type: string
          readOnly: true
          description: Fully qualified resource ID for the resource.
        name:
          type: string
          readOnly: true
          description: The name of the resource.
        type:
          type: string
          readOnly: true
          description: The type of the resource.
        location:
          type: string
          readOnly: true
          description: The geo-location where the resource lives.
        properties:
          type: object
          properties:
            createdAt:
              type: string
              format: date-time
              readOnly: true
              description: Exact time the message was created.
            updatedAt:
              type: string
              format: date-time
              readOnly: true
              description: The exact time the message was updated.
            userMetadata:
              type: string
              description: User Metadata is a placeholder to store user-defined string data with maximum length 1024.
        systemData:
          $ref: '#/components/schemas/SystemData'
    ConsumerGroupListResult:
      type: object
      description: The result of the List Consumer Groups operation.
      properties:
        value:
          type: array
          items:
            $ref: '#/components/schemas/ConsumerGroup'
          description: Result of the List Consumer Groups operation.
        nextLink:
          type: string
          description: Link to the next set of results. Not empty if Value contains incomplete list of Consumer Groups.
    ErrorDetail:
      type: object
      description: The error detail.
      properties:
        code:
          type: string
          readOnly: true
          description: The error code.
        message:
          type: string
          readOnly: true
          description: The error message.
        target:
          type: string
          readOnly: true
          description: The error target.
        details:
          type: array
          items:
            $ref: '#/components/schemas/ErrorDetail'
          readOnly: true
          description: The error details.
        additionalInfo:
          type: array
          items:
            $ref: '#/components/schemas/ErrorAdditionalInfo'
          readOnly: true
          description: The error additional info.
    ErrorAdditionalInfo:
      type: object
      description: The resource management error additional info.
      properties:
        type:
          type: string
          readOnly: true
          description: The additional info type.
        info:
          type: object
          readOnly: true
          description: The additional info.
  parameters:
    SubscriptionIdParameter:
      name: subscriptionId
      in: path
      required: true
      description: Subscription credentials that uniquely identify a Microsoft Azure subscription. The subscription ID forms part of the URI for every service call.
      schema:
        type: string
    EventHubNameParameter:
      name: eventHubName
      in: path
      required: true
      description: The Event Hub name.
      schema:
        type: string
        minLength: 1
        maxLength: 256
    ApiVersionParameter:
      name: api-version
      in: query
      required: true
      description: Client API version.
      schema:
        type: string
        default: '2024-01-01'
    NamespaceNameParameter:
      name: namespaceName
      in: path
      required: true
      description: The Namespace name.
      schema:
        type: string
        minLength: 6
        maxLength: 50
        pattern: ^[a-zA-Z][a-zA-Z0-9-]{6,50}[a-zA-Z0-9]$
    ConsumerGroupNameParameter:
      name: consumerGroupName
      in: path
      required: true
      description: The consumer group name.
      schema:
        type: string
        minLength: 1
        maxLength: 50
    ResourceGroupNameParameter:
      name: resourceGroupName
      in: path
      required: true
      description: Name of the resource group within the Azure subscription.
      schema:
        type: string
        minLength: 1
        maxLength: 90
  securitySchemes:
    azure_auth:
      type: oauth2
      description: Azure Active Directory OAuth2 Flow.
      flows:
        implicit:
          authorizationUrl: https://login.microsoftonline.com/common/oauth2/authorize
          scopes:
            user_impersonation: Impersonate your user account
